Origins and early days
Collectible card games began their journey in the late 1980s, but it wasn't until "Magic: The Gathering" was launched in 1993 that the genre truly made its mark. This game introduced the concept of building your own deck and using these cards to defeat opponents, revolutionizing how people played and collected cards.
In the following years, several other games became popular, including Pokémon and Yu-Gi-Oh!, which helped cement TCG as an important part of gaming culture.
